What is M2M Authentication?

Machine to Machine (M2M) authentication refers to the process that verifies the identities of devices communicating over a network. As businesses increasingly rely on interconnected systems, M2M authentication becomes critical in preventing unauthorized access and ensuring secure data exchanges. This technology plays a vital role in various sectors, including manufacturing, healthcare, and transportation, where equipment needs to communicate seamlessly and securely.

Key Components of M2M Authentication

To implement effective M2M authentication, several key components must be considered:

  • Device Identity Management: Each device must have a unique identity to be authenticated accurately.
  • Secure Communication Protocols: Utilization of encryption technologies to protect data in transit.
  • Scalability: The solution should accommodate the growing number of devices in an IoT environment.
  • Real-Time Monitoring: Continuous assessment of device behavior to detect anomalies.
